① Equipment structure module
The equipment structure module consists of the equipment body and the drum, and is made of 304L stainless steel (optional 316L). |
② Filtering module
The filtration module consists of several independent and detachable filter screens, which are made of 316L stainless steel wire with a diameter of micrometers through special processes (different precision filters are selected according to the incoming water quality, and imported and domestic filters are also provided). |
|
③ Drive system
The drive system consists of a reduction motor, transmission shaft, central bearing, etc. |
④ Backwash system
The backwash system consists of backwash water pump, pipeline, backwash water filter, nozzle, collection tank, and sewage pipe. |
|
⑤ Control system
The equipment adopts a PLC automatic control system. The PLC control system is installed in the electrical control cabinet and can communicate with the central control room in the factory through networking. |
1. Oil free lubricated bearings at the inlet end. During the working process, the loss of solid lubricant is minimal, and it can be self replenished. It has a high load-bearing capacity and, when combined with a water cooling system, can completely solve tile burning.
|
2. Gear set transmission structure at the outlet end. There is no problem of unstable chain transmission, and the maintenance cycle is long.
|
3. Oil filling structure for the bearing at the outlet end. External refueling structure eliminates the need for operators to enter the interior of the machine compartment, reducing maintenance difficulty and improving user usability.
|
4. A drum with concentric ends, precision coaxiality processing, and repeated dynamic balancing correction. Intended to prevent the common problem of drum deformation after years of operation on the market.
|
|||
5. Based on rich on-site experience, filter screens with different accuracies. At the same time, it has achieved three core indicators of the filter: high precision, long lifespan, and no degradation in processing capacity.
|
6. Backwash nozzle system for external main and internal auxiliary. Even in the face of excessive dosing or high SS inlet water, it can operate stably, expanding the range of inlet water quality of the equipment and extending the maintenance cycle of the filter screen.
|
7. Humanized electronic control logic. Based on on-site experience, we have added some user-friendly settings, such as linking the water level gauge in the inlet chamber with the bypass solenoid valve. When the water level in the inlet chamber is too high, it indicates a decrease in the network capacity of the filter. At this time, the bypass valve will automatically open to reduce the risk of filter damage.

| model | HWL-3000 | HWL-5000 | HWL-10000 | HWL-15000 | HWL-20000 | HWL-25000 | HWL-30000 |
| Processing capacity (m)3/d) | 3000 | 5000 | 10000 | 15000 | 20000 | 25000 | 30000 |
| Dimensions (mm) | 2900×1220 ×1470 |
2900×1600 ×2060 |
3800×1600 ×2220 |
4700×1600 ×2220 |
5600×1600 ×2220 |
5600×1760 ×2500 |
6500×1760 ×2500 |
| Filter area (m)2) | 1.5 | 2.5 | 5 | 7.5 | 10 | 12 | 15 |
| Outlet Diameter | DN200 | DN300 | DN500 | DN500 | DN600 | DN700 | DN700 |
| Reduction motor power (KW) | 0.55 | 0.55 | 0.75 | 1.1 | 1.5 | 1.5 | 1.5 |
| Backwash pump power (KW) | 1.1 | 1.1 | 2.2 | 3 | 4 | 4 | 5.5 |
| Backwash water consumption (m)3/d) | 20 | 20 | 40 | 60 | 80 | 80 | 100 |
| Backwash pressure (bar) | 7.5 | 7.5 | 7.5 | 7.5 | 7.5 | 7.5 | 7.5 |
